BALSAMIC VINAIGRETTE RECIPE



Balsamic Vinaigrette Recipe image

Slightly sweet, tangy balsamic vinaigrette is versatile as can be. As a dressing for salad, drizzled on roasted vegetables and chicken wraps, everyone loves this recipe.

Provided by Mary Younkin

Categories     Condiment

Time 5m

Number Of Ingredients 7

2 tablespoons honey
1 tablespoon dijon mustard
1/2 teaspoon fine sea salt
1/2 teaspoon freshly crushed black pepper (finely ground)
1 large garlic clove (minced)
1/4 cup balsamic vinegar
3/4 cup extra virgin olive oil

Steps:

  • In a small mixing bowl, whisk together the honey, balsamic, mustard, salt, pepper and garlic. Add the oil and whisk thoroughly to combine. Continue whisking until the dressing is fully emulsified.
  • Store in a jar with a lid and refrigerate. Shake well before serving. Enjoy!

PERFECT BALSAMIC DRESSING (AKA VINAIGRETTE)



Perfect Balsamic Dressing (aka Vinaigrette) image

This homemade balsamic dressing recipe is a top Google search for a reason-it goes with just about everything! It's super simple to whip up a batch and makes any salad or veggie taste amazing. If you love it, please leave a star rating in the comments below to help other readers in our community.

Provided by Elizabeth Rider

Categories     Salad Dressing

Time 2m

Number Of Ingredients 5

1/2 cup good-quality balsamic vinegar
1/2 cup extra virgin olive oil
1 teaspoon wholegrain mustard
1/4 teaspoon sea salt
1/8 teaspoon freshly ground black pepper

Steps:

  • Place all ingredients in a container with a tight-fitting lid (a mason jar works great).
  • Shake vigorously for 30 seconds until emulsified. You can also emulsify your vinaigrette in a blender or food processor (work on low, increasing the speed as you stream in the oil last). I only use a blender when working in extra large quantities. Up to about a cup, shaking it like crazy in a mason jar works great (and there's way less clean up.)
  • Alternatively, you can whisk all ingredients together in a small bowl. To use this method, whisk all ingredients except the olive oil in a small bowl, then stream in the olive oil while you continue to whisk until the dressing has emulsified.

BASIL-BALSAMIC VINAIGRETTE



Basil-Balsamic Vinaigrette image

Your greens will thank you for this bold dressing with garlic, basil and balsamic vinegar.

Provided by Food Network Kitchen

Time 5m

Yield 1 cup

Number Of Ingredients 5

1/4 cup balsamic vinegar
2 tablespoons chopped fresh basil
2 teaspoons minced garlic
Kosher salt and freshly ground black pepper
3/4 cup extra-virgin olive oil

Steps:

  • Whisk together the vinegar, basil, garlic and a generous pinch of salt in a small bowl. Gradually whisk in the oil, starting with a few drops and then adding the rest in a steady stream to make a smooth, slightly thick dressing. Whisk in a couple turns of freshly ground black pepper.

FIG BALSAMIC VINAIGRETTE



Fig Balsamic Vinaigrette image

Sweet and Tangy. Makes any salad Exciting! ... and what I did with all those extra figs! This was inspired by my friend, Ellen.

Provided by Sweetiebarbara

Categories     Low Protein

Time 1h30m

Yield 3 1/2 cups, 68-70 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 6

1 lb fig (fresh)
1 cup water (filtered)
2 ounces shallots (very thinly sliced)
3 tablespoons olive oil
1 teaspoon sugar
1 1/2 cups balsamic vinegar

Steps:

  • Simmer Figs in water until very soft.
  • Puree with hand held wand.
  • Keep on low heat, and continue until it reaches a thick consistency.
  • Sweat shallots over medium low heat in olive oil, and cook until tender (about 15 minutes).
  • Add sugar and cook another 5 minutes.
  • Add to fig mix and puree again.
  • Add vinegar.
  • Bottle and refrigerate.

BALSAMIC VINAIGRETTE



Balsamic Vinaigrette image

A dash of lemon juice adds bright flavor to this tart balsamic vinaigrette, perfect for any salad.

Provided by Martha Stewart

Categories     Food & Cooking     Cuisine-Inspired Recipes     Italian Recipes

Yield Makes 3/4 cup

Number Of Ingredients 5

1/4 cup balsamic vinegar
1 teaspoon Dijon mustard
1 teaspoon freshly squeezed lemon juice
1/2 cup extra-virgin olive oil
Coarse salt and freshly ground pepper

Steps:

  • In a medium bowl, whisk together vinegar, mustard, and lemon juice. Add olive oil in a slow, steady stream, whisking until combined. Season with salt and pepper.
